Revised Bruntsfield villa extension takes a backseat to appease planners

Hackland + Dore has submitted new plans to extend a C-listed Bruntsfield villa after previous attempts to obtain planning were thrown out by Scottish ministers on appeal.

Previously subdivided into flats and with an existing sandstone extension dating from the 1990s already in place the latest plans call for the creation of an additional storey of accommodation in contrasting metal cladding at 13 Chamberlain Road.

Hackland + Dore have sought to answer previous criticisms by orientating to the rear of the property with recessed roof additions to minimise intrusion. In a design statement, outlining their revised design the architects wrote: "The proposal has been significantly revised by reducing its scale, primary orientation and reconfiguring its relationship to the existing extension. The extension is now focussed to the rear of the property, with the volume recessed away from the front elevations of both the villa and existing extension.

"The front elevation has been further simplified, being viewed externally as a mansard roof to cap the existing exten-sion. A glazed recessed section acts to provide a visual delineation to the gable of the existing villa with a sharp interface between the existing and proposed elements. The simplified form allows this to be a clearly subservient roof addition, avoiding the impression of a two-storey extension.

"The rear elevation uses simple vertical language with elements of folded metal to emphasise the generous openings onto the garden space."

The existing masonry extension will be left otherwise untouched.
